LA FARGE, Oliver

Pulitzer Prize winning American author who served as President of the National Association on Indian Affairs. Extremely rare A.L.S. thanking recipient for his suggestions on rearrangement of one of La Farge's works. 1 page, 8vo. N.p., Nov. 18, 1945.

1901-1963 Signed in full: "Your observations on a possible rearrangement of Raw Material are interesting. Rearrangement is the wrong word, your suggestion goes deeper. There is the rub. Your idea postulates another intention, and in doing so steps outside of criticism into the question of whether one should have undertaken that particular work, or something else...It's stimulating to receive such comments..."
